Calibration software MCC-MT

Application

  • Monte Carlo simulation spectra of gamma, beta and radiation;
  • Characterization detectors and detection systems;
  • Calibration of instruments used for ionizing radiation detection and measurements without using the hazardous ionizing radiation for human health;
  • Obtaining clear picture of the internal processes of radiation transfer in order to optimize the design of the measuring devices and their protection;
  • Acceleration, simplification and reduction in the cost of design and optimization of ionizing radiation detection systems;

Features

  • High accuracy of calculations
  • Detailed 3D-scene based on Open GL graphics technology providing maximum representation and visibility of modeling
  • Availability of replenished database of sources and materials
  • Possibility of creating the maximally complex measuring systems
  • Forming multidetector systems and schemes of coincidence
  • Display of the results in the form of an ideal and real spectrum
  • Tracing and drawing trajectories of particles during calculation process
  • Availability of the ready and test projects in the distributive package (HPGe, scintillation detectors, protective lead shielding, volumetric sources and samples, etc.)
  • Accounting cascade summation (‘Full cascade’ source type)
